Output 90bfe3c393a93fe3202e7c4e8948a00e7a36dd091cecfd417e8db721d270ed67:80

value
41403791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97910fff65c34b2297dc9a48177dd3a3c3a95ea2 OP_EQUAL
address
3FWRjdRDz7wU763CokTNZRf4F9363BuZK1
transaction
90bfe3c393a93fe3202e7c4e8948a00e7a36dd091cecfd417e8db721d270ed67
confirmations
309138
spent
true